Abstract

Dynamic changes have been making their mark on the motor industry for some years. Manufacturer’s demands on the development partner are as drastic as they are clear:

Structural performance adjustments and organisational rearrangement alone are not enough. The 6th discussion forum of the 2nd European Engineering User Conference shows the solutions currently under review by experts.
